I understand you receive dozens of suggestions for projects, but I thought I might throw another on the list.

 

There are now a number of excellent resin and PE correction and update sets for this kit, but what it also needs badly is a windscreen and canopy. They are a little short in height and look a little flat when assembled. The way the canopy is engineered creates a distortion at the join of the clear part and the lower fairing...which is also is difficult to glue together. 

 

There must be hundreds of these kits out there but I don't know if people are still willing to tackle the beast. Not sure if there would be a market which would make the effort worthwhile for you.

 

Anyway, just a thought...and I suppose too there is the question of which canopy profile to use.
